Wadgassen: crime 29 years ago? Police searched the forest

First of all, the ground with sticks will be examined to find possible changes in the soil, said a spokesman of the national police headquarters in Saarbrücken on Monday. The police officers discovered Striking when Poking around a little, will mark the spot and investigated in more detail: "Then also a little bit of earth is removed, and a deep dug out of the ground." In the course of their investigations had revealed some new information: according to the body in September 1991, the missing man is said to have been buried in the forest area. Recently, the police had arrested three suspects men at the age of 53 to 55 years. The Germans, with today's places of residence in Berlin, as well as in the Saarland, Heusweiler, and Riegelsberg are suspected, the man in the forest is killed and the corpse, then buried.

Last week, the police had prepared the several 100-square metre site for the quest: the branches and bushes were cut away. Cadaver dogs should, at the earliest, by the end of this week, the spokesman said. A total of 20 police officers on-site - including experts from the Federal criminal police office are.

the special feature of the search was that "the case is already so long back," said the spokesman. You was aware, "that is, after almost 30 years, of course, difficult: Whether you will find there's in fact a not density or density of the Earth's mass or not". The three arrested have not commented yet on the allegations.

The man from Völklingen since 1991 as missing. Then the investigation revealed no clues to his whereabouts. In may of this year, there have been then "hints from the environment of the now accused," to the effect that the death of the Missing responsible. Investigations have corroborated the suspicion.
